kuma4649 / mml2vgm

GNU General Public License v3.0
108 stars 10 forks source link

Support import midi #118

Open denjhang opened 3 years ago

denjhang commented 3 years ago

I think if MML2VGM can be more user-friendly, it should support the import of midi options, even if the support is not complete, I also hope to have this feature.

denjhang commented 3 years ago

I know that there is an independent program that can implement midi2mml, but that program is not easy to use. I hope that such a program can be directly integrated into MML2VGM IDE.

kuma4649 commented 3 years ago

image ありますよ。。。

kuma4649 commented 3 years ago

あ、インポートか... 失礼しました。

kuma4649 commented 3 years ago

作り始めました。

一応TAG528で一部のMIDファイルは取り込めます。 ただし、完全ではありません。

変換後のmmlの見た目についてですが、 このまま作り進めても、見にくい状態はほとんど改善する見込みはありません。 結局、手動で調整が必要になります。 それでも、あなたはこの機能が欲しいですか?

denjhang commented 3 years ago

This feature is better than nothing. Especially with the dynamic channel allocation function, then it will be very useful.

kuma4649 commented 3 years ago

であれば、もう少しまともに動作するようになったらそれで完了としますね。

dynamic~については別スレッドで回答済みで、サポート予定はありません。

denjhang commented 3 years ago

I hope that by improving the functions of MML2VGM, MIDI can be easily converted to VGM or other chip music formats. This greatly reduces the difficulty of VGM arrangement, and various tracks can be easily produced and transplanted.

kuma4649 commented 3 years ago

不可逆なコンバートですけども。